Transaction 591a7b1f6219efa97586d13a042c6c852b2eb85429f8421a1dae70033ae694d3
3 Input
2 Outputs
- 591a7b1f6219efa97586d13a042c6c852b2eb85429f8421a1dae70033ae694d3:0
- 591a7b1f6219efa97586d13a042c6c852b2eb85429f8421a1dae70033ae694d3:1
value 15822
address 16q4nxMSzjvaq1uMtiETyD7xSmfpfvjRCQ
value 86019
address 1Dk2AjAUjfs3Egp81FoScriJwEzebeshsU